From 06f787e840fbdae818436af16fda4e6a6408ed4a Mon Sep 17 00:00:00 2001 From: Loc Mai Date: Sat, 1 Jan 2022 01:09:04 +0700 Subject: [PATCH] fix: sync-wave order --- bootstrap/app/templates/bootstrap.yaml | 4 +++- bootstrap/app/templates/global.yaml | 2 +- bootstrap/app/templates/platform.yaml | 2 ++ bootstrap/app/templates/system.yaml | 2 +- 4 files changed, 7 insertions(+), 3 deletions(-) diff --git a/bootstrap/app/templates/bootstrap.yaml b/bootstrap/app/templates/bootstrap.yaml index fd9ef501..5b6f35dc 100644 --- a/bootstrap/app/templates/bootstrap.yaml +++ b/bootstrap/app/templates/bootstrap.yaml @@ -4,6 +4,8 @@ kind: AppProject metadata: name: bootstrap namespace: argocd + annotations: + argocd.argoproj.io/sync-wave: "-1" spec: description: bootstrap project clusterResourceWhitelist: @@ -21,7 +23,7 @@ metadata: name: bootstrap namespace: argocd annotations: - argocd.argoproj.io/sync-wave: "-1" + argocd.argoproj.io/sync-wave: "0" finalizers: - resources-finalizer.argocd.argoproj.io spec: diff --git a/bootstrap/app/templates/global.yaml b/bootstrap/app/templates/global.yaml index b663c7ed..a2c5a877 100644 --- a/bootstrap/app/templates/global.yaml +++ b/bootstrap/app/templates/global.yaml @@ -21,7 +21,7 @@ metadata: name: global namespace: argocd annotations: - argocd.argoproj.io/sync-wave: "-1" + argocd.argoproj.io/sync-wave: "0" finalizers: - resources-finalizer.argocd.argoproj.io spec: diff --git a/bootstrap/app/templates/platform.yaml b/bootstrap/app/templates/platform.yaml index bf572423..f43bc578 100644 --- a/bootstrap/app/templates/platform.yaml +++ b/bootstrap/app/templates/platform.yaml @@ -22,6 +22,8 @@ kind: Application metadata: name: platform namespace: argocd + annotations: + argocd.argoproj.io/sync-wave: "0" finalizers: - resources-finalizer.argocd.argoproj.io spec: diff --git a/bootstrap/app/templates/system.yaml b/bootstrap/app/templates/system.yaml index 9c9f477c..3ebec9e3 100644 --- a/bootstrap/app/templates/system.yaml +++ b/bootstrap/app/templates/system.yaml @@ -21,7 +21,7 @@ metadata: name: system namespace: argocd annotations: - argocd.argoproj.io/sync-wave: "-1" + argocd.argoproj.io/sync-wave: "0" finalizers: - resources-finalizer.argocd.argoproj.io spec: